
Elisabeth Bulbena
Co-FounderElisabeth is a qualified Spanish teacher, a qualified Modern Languages teacher and a qualified Teacher of Spanish as a Foreign Language (ELE) with more than 21 years of teaching experience.
Throughout her career, she has taught Spanish, Catalan and English in three different countries, working with children, teenagers and adults from a wide range of linguistic and cultural backgrounds.
She has extensive experience preparing students for Spanish GCSE, A-Level Spanish and DELE (A1–C2) examinations, helping many achieve outstanding results. Many of her students continue their Spanish studies beyond school, developing not only excellent examination results but also the confidence to communicate naturally in Spanish.
Alongside her work as a Spanish teacher, Elisabeth is a certified ADHD Coach, Autism Coach and a specialist in High Learning Potential (Gifted Education). She is a member of the research team on High Learning Potential at the Institute for Education of the University of Barcelona and has completed specialist training in gifted education, pedagogy, neurodiversity and inclusive education.
Elisabeth also has a strong background in music education as the founder and director of Beethoven Music School in London. Her experience in both music and language education has strengthened her understanding of listening, communication and how students learn most effectively.
She has extensive experience teaching children, teenagers and adults with ADHD, Autism, High Learning Potential (Gifted Education), Dyslexia, Williams syndrome and other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ND).
Elisabeth is fluent in Catalan, Spanish, English and Italian, and has an intermediate level of French and German.
As a multilingual educator, Elisabeth understands first-hand the language-learning journey. She knows both the challenges and the excitement of learning a foreign language and enjoys helping students develop confidence through meaningful communication rather than memorisation.
As well as being an experienced teacher, Elisabeth is also the mother of multilingual children. Watching them acquire several languages from an early age has further strengthened her understanding of how children learn languages naturally and reinforced her belief in the importance of listening, communication and meaningful interaction.
Elisabeth also has extensive experience supporting home-educated learners and private candidates. As a home-educating parent herself, she understands the opportunities and challenges of personalised education and enjoys working closely with families to help students achieve their academic and personal goals. She is also happy to offer general guidance on the process of entering students for official qualifications such as GCSE and A-Level Spanish as private candidates.
